Coaches and Starcraft:
Starcraft NEEDS coaches. No I am not talking about analytical coaches, I am talking about out of game coaches. There comes a time in every player's career where they get frustrated at themselves, or at the game. For example, you are not happy with your play recently, you are on a slump and losing all the time. What do you do? You grind more games and practice. Well guess what, YOU ARE WRONG! A lot of players seem to forget how important player health is. Your mind does NOT operate independent from your body. Being healthy and active is just as crucial to success as practice games are, if not, more important. Some players do exercise daily and that is great! But not everyone does that and I feel teams really need to hire coaches to make sure your players are exercising. Another reason I feel out of games coaches are essential is because a lot of players have personal issues and need someone to talk to. Many players dropped out of college or are fresh out of high school to play Starcraft professionally and may be under a lot of stress from not getting results. That feeling is what all starcraft players feel when they are not achieving the results they want to achieve or in this case, NEED to achieve. As one could imagine, this is a stressful thing for any one person to go through alone and sometimes people need someone to talk to.

Many players are extremely talented, and are blocked by some sort of mental barrier. IdrA immediately comes to mind. I feel like with more out of game coaching, players like him would still be around today. They need someone to show them that they are NOT all in, and there are other options they may have not considered.

TL;DR: SC2 needs out of games coaches to help players overcome mental barriers, and make sure they are healthy. Grinding out games is not how you become better at starcraft once you reach a certain point of skill and commitment to the game.

I know that Robert Yip is a peak performance coach that works with TLO. Richard Lewis did a great interview with him, as did team liquid (?) His performance jumped significantly after he sought help IMO, which is pretty impressive since he was pretty meh for most of WoL.

I agree that peak performance coaching is a very useful, under-utilized tool for esports athletes. I'd guess that not enough people seek such help due to the negative 'self help' stigma, and the inability to secure funds to pay for such services. (Very, very expensive)
